Core Insights - The World Meteorological Organization reports that concentrations of greenhouse gases such as carbon dioxide, methane, and nitrous oxide reached historic highs in 2024, indicating a significant environmental concern [1] Group 1: Greenhouse Gases Overview - Greenhouse gases act like a "thermal blanket" for the Earth, absorbing and re-radiating heat, which is essential for maintaining suitable temperatures for life [1] - Common greenhouse gases include carbon dioxide, methane, nitrous oxide, and fluorinated gases [1] Group 2: Measurement and Impact of Greenhouse Gas Concentration - The concentration of greenhouse gases is measured in parts per million (ppm) for carbon dioxide and parts per billion (ppb) for methane and nitrous oxide, indicating very low levels in the atmosphere [3] - An increase in greenhouse gas concentration enhances the greenhouse effect, leading to global warming and extreme weather events, which can significantly impact agriculture, energy, and health sectors [8][10] Group 3: Causes of Increased Greenhouse Gas Concentration - Human activities such as fossil fuel combustion, agricultural practices, and land-use changes are the primary drivers of increased greenhouse gas emissions, surpassing natural absorption capabilities [7] - The decline in the carbon absorption capacity of ecosystems, such as oceans and land, contributes to the rising concentrations of greenhouse gases [4][5] Group 4: Effects on Climate and Agriculture - The rise in greenhouse gas concentrations is linked to more frequent and intense extreme weather events, such as heatwaves and droughts, which pose challenges to agricultural production [9][10] - Changes in climate are causing agricultural zones to shift northward and westward, affecting crop yields and introducing new health risks due to the spread of tropical diseases [10] Group 5: Mitigation and International Cooperation - Addressing climate change requires improved monitoring and early warning systems for natural disasters, as well as integrating climate risk considerations into agriculture, urban planning, and public health [11] - Global cooperation is essential for effective climate governance, with a focus on low-carbon initiatives and support for developing countries in adapting to climate change [12]

Core Viewpoint - The article emphasizes that global warming is a reality driven primarily by human activities, leading to increasingly extreme weather events and significant impacts on the environment and society [2][4]. Group 1: Causes of Global Warming - The scientific consensus is that human activities, particularly the emission of greenhouse gases like carbon dioxide and methane, are the main drivers of global warming, with current warming rates being 50 times faster than natural cycles [4]. - Industrial emissions and livestock farming, especially cattle, contribute significantly to greenhouse gas emissions, with methane being a major byproduct of cattle digestion [4][5]. Group 2: Effects of Global Warming - Global warming leads to more frequent and severe extreme weather events, including droughts, floods, and heatwaves, due to increased evaporation and changes in atmospheric moisture [8][9]. - The melting of glaciers and ice caps contributes to rising sea levels, but the more immediate concern is the increase in extreme weather patterns, which can lead to both droughts and floods [8][9]. - The phenomenon of "critical points" is highlighted, where irreversible changes, such as the melting of ice sheets and the release of methane from permafrost, could accelerate global warming and lead to more extreme climate conditions [12][13]. Group 3: Potential Benefits and Adaptations - One potential benefit of global warming is the northward shift of precipitation patterns, which could lead to increased rainfall in certain areas, although this does not guarantee improved agricultural conditions due to increased evaporation rates [14][15]. - The article discusses the possibility of adapting to extreme weather by changing living patterns, such as relocating to cooler regions during extreme heat [16]. Group 4: Societal Implications - Extreme weather events pose direct threats to vulnerable populations, exacerbating social inequalities and impacting livelihoods [16]. - The article notes that efforts in climate change mitigation, such as reforestation and renewable energy deployment, are crucial and highlights China's proactive measures in addressing global warming [16].
